@mr1030 Another email response received this morning GMT.
Hi, thanks for your message back. The Coins of the World series and all our statues are available to the global market. I don't have any retail partners in the EU yet. We do ship to the UK, but I know that comes with a high customs/ duty. I recently shipped a statue to a customer and his duty was only 5% using the following code:
925 Silver Statue
HS Tariff No. 9705000020
VAT reduced rate 5% - Duty Exempt
For a $1200 statue, the VAT was 50. GBP
We are currently relocating to a larger facility in Singapore and have disabled retail sales on our website until we are fully up and running again. I expect to be back online with new models by October 15th.
